Current Market Patterns

Urban Progress and Development

Melbourne, the main city of Victoria, remains a crucial area for expansion and development. Its vibrant cultural environment, top-tier universities, and robust employment opportunities draw interest from people both within the country and abroad. The inner residential areas the city are specifically demanded, with a considerable desire for apartments and townhouses near centers and transportation options.

Regional Appearance

In the last few years, there has been an obvious shift towards regional Victoria. Towns such as Geelong, Ballarat, and Bendigo have seen increased interest due to their relative price, lifestyle appeal, and improved facilities. The pandemic accelerated this trend, as remote work chances enabled more people to think about living outside the metropolitan area without compromising profession prospects.

Housing Price

While Victoria provides a variety of real estate options, price remains an issue, particularly in Melbourne. Typical house rates in some inner-city suburbs have actually reached record highs, making it challenging for first-time purchasers to enter the marketplace. However, federal government initiatives such as First Home Owner Grants and mark duty concessions intend to reduce a few of these pressures.

Rental Market Characteristics

Victoria's rental market is diverse, with different patterns in urban and regional areas. In Melbourne, rental job rates have changed, influenced by aspects like international migration and trainee accommodations. On the other hand, regional areas have actually experienced tighter rental markets, driven by increased demand and minimal supply.

Key Aspects Influencing the Marketplace

Economic Status

The overall health of the economy has a profound influence on the real estate sector. Victoria's varied economy, strengthened by key markets like financing, education, and healthcare, assists to cultivate a thriving residential or commercial property market. However, sudden financial shocks, such as those activated by global health crises, can considerably deteriorate buyer self-confidence and trigger property worths to change.

Infrastructure Developments

Substantial infrastructure jobs, consisting of road upgrades, new public transportation lines, and urban renewal efforts, positively impact home values. Areas gaining from enhanced connectivity and facilities typically see increased demand and cost development.

Demography

Victoria is among Australia's fastest-growing states, with Melbourne anticipated to overtake Sydney as the country's biggest city by 2026. Population growth drives real estate need, prompting new domestic advancements and increasing competition among purchasers.

Government Practices

Federal government policies, consisting of interest rate modifications by the Reserve Bank of Australia (RBA) and real estate price plans, influence market dynamics. Low-interest rates have traditionally supported home financial investment, while regulatory changes can affect financier belief and market activity.
